Yes. Storm damage is often invisible from ground level. Hail can crack shingles and loosen granules without obvious signs. Wind can lift edges and break seals that lead to leaks weeks later. A professional inspection after any significant storm is strongly recommended.
In Washington, the most common storm-related roof damage comes from high winds that lift shingles, hail that cracks and dents materials, and heavy rain that exploits any existing vulnerabilities. Fallen tree limbs are also a significant cause after severe storms.
It depends on the extent of damage. Localized damage from a tree branch or minor hail can often be repaired. Widespread hail damage or major structural impact usually requires replacement. We give honest assessments — we will never recommend more work than necessary.
